The Tudor Rose  

The Tudor Rose is a free house and dates back to the 15th-century. It retains much of its original character and charm. There is an oak studded door which leads in to the pub and a small lobby lounge area and two bars, where real ale beers and informal bar meals are served. Ales on at the time were Woodfordes Wherry and Iceni Celtic Queen. The front bar has a high ceiling with beams and a large 'wheel' chandelier. The back bar has more room with benches around the edge - but it also has a juke box! Bar food is available here and is traditional and simple, but filling. Prices range from ?2.75 for soup to ?6.50 for scampi. The first floor restaurant is particularly striking with its exposed beams and whitewashed walls. You can order more extensive food (up to 9pm) here such as salmon, venison and steaks. Vegetarian meals available. No food Sunday evening. The restaurant is no smoking and sadly does not offer a way up for the disabled. Outside is a beer garden for the summer. Accommodation is available here, bedroom styles and sizes vary, but each room is well maintained and the more recently redecorated rooms look cheerful with their co-ordinated colour schemes. There are 13 en-suite rooms; single ?35-?40, double ?50 - ?65. Special Breaks available.
